Porthcothan to Edinburgh by walk, bus and night bus

The journey time between Porthcothan and Edinburgh is around 20h 15m and covers a distance of around 627 miles. This includes an average layover time of around 2h. Services are operated by Go Cornwall Bus and National Express. Typically seven services run weekly, although weekend and holiday schedules can vary so check in advance.

National Express

National Express Coaches are a quick and convenient way of travelling around the UK. Over 550 National Express coaches run on Britain's roads every day, serving over 900 destinations across the UK. National Express Coaches carry around 19 million passenger journeys every year. For added convenience, National Express operate coach services to all major UK airports 24 hours per day, and is on its way to being 100% wheelchair accessible. The company also has a 24-hour control centre that receives a GPS signal to update on location, speed and the temperature inside coaches, ensuring the smoothest journey possible.
